Full House Back On Nick at Nite; Me-TV Remembers Billingsley, Bosley; Sitcom Stars on Talk Shows (Week of October 25, 2010)

Full House is returning to Nick at Nite starting Monday (Oct. 25), but it should be called Nick at Morning, because it will only air every morning in the 6:00am hour. The series has been airing on sister network TeenNick since September 2009 and now will move back to Nick at Nite. Full House hasn't aired on Nick at Nite since April 2009 and incidentally it was airing at 6am then, too. The series will replace an hour of Family Matters on Nick at Nite in the 6am hour as that series will still remain in the Mon-Sat 5am hour (Home Improvement is Sundays at 5am).
TeenNick will air its last Full House airing this Sunday (Oct. 24) from 6am-9am. Starting Oct. 25, the timeslots will be replaced by an hour each of True Jackson VP, Zoey 101 and Drake & Josh.

It looks like we are not getting any national tribute marathons in memory of Barbara Billingsley or Tom Bosley, but of course Me-TV in Chicago will remember both greats with classic marathons this weekend! Me-TV Chicago is paying tribute to Barbara Billingsley, best known as June Cleaver from Leave it to Beaver, and Tom Bosley, who played Richie's dad Howard Cunningham on Happy Days, with special marathons this weekend.
Tune in this Saturday from 1-7 PM CT for "A Tribute to Barbara Billingsley" with select episodes of Leave it to Beaver. On Sunday from 1-7PM CT, Me-TV will air "A Tribute to Tom Bosley" with a Happy Days marathon.
Leave it to Beaver episodes airing are: "Ward's Baseball," "Wally and Dudley," "In the Soup," "Beaver's Long Night," "Lumpy's Car Trouble," "Wally's License," "Beaver, the Hero," "The Party Spoiler," "More Blessed to Give," "The Credit Card," "Lumpy's Scholarship" and "Family Scrapbook."
Happy Days episodes airing are: "Hardware Jungle," "Breaking Up Is Hard To Do," "Be the First On Your Block," "Richie's Car," "Howard's 45th Fiasco," "Marion Rebels," "Grandpa's Visit," "Richie Almost Dies," "Fonzie for the Defense," "Married Strangers," "The Hucksters" and "Father and Son."
Barbara Billingsley died on Saturday, October 16 and Tom Bosley died on Tuesday, October 19. Me-TV Chicago is on Comcast 223 in Chicago, RCN 14, WOW 17 (city), WOW 19 (suburbs), AT&T U-verse 23, DIRECTV 23 and Dish Network 23, all in the Chicago area only.
